Index ソフト・ハード Linuxタスク | ユーザ管理 |
ユーザ管理 su sudo visudo useradd usermod userdel groupadd groupmod groupdel passwd |
ユーザ管理 ( ユーザーとグループ ) ・ログインユーザの確認 $ /usr/bin/who $ /usr/bin/wsu (ユーザ切替え) ・書式 su [-] [ユーザ名]・オプション 「 - 」 新たにログインした時と同様の環境に初期化 なし 元の環境が維持される。(カレントディレクトリが変わらないなど)sudo (rootの権限でコマンドを実行) ・コマンドの実行時にコマンド実行者のパスワードが求められる。 一定時間(デフォルト 5分)経つと、再びパスワードが求められる。・設定ファイル /etc/sudoers で権限を付与された特定のユーザが使用できる。 visudo (sudoコマンドの設定ファイル/etc/sudoersを編集) ・設定の整合性や文法エラーをチェックする。 ・実行にはroot権限が必要 ・/etc/sudoers ファイルの書式 ユーザ名 接続元ホスト=[([ユーザ][:グループ])] [タグ] コマンド 誰が どのホストから =(誰に切り替えて) 何を・/etc/sudoers ファイルの設定例 user1 ALL=(ALL) ALL user1 ALL=(root) NOPASSWD:ALL (ユーザのパスワードを要求しない。) user1 ALL=(ALL) /usr/sbin/shutdownuseradd (新規ユーザを作成) ・書式 useradd [オプション] ユーザ名・オプション
usermod (ユーザを修正) ・書式 usermod [オプション] ユーザ名・オプション
userdel (ユーザと関連ファイルを削除) ・書式 userdel [オプション] ユーザ名・オプション -r ユーザのホームディレクトリも削除groupadd (新規グループを作成) ・書式 groupadd [オプション] グループ名・オプション
groupmod (グループを修正) ・書式 groupmod [オプション] グループ名・オプション
・groupdel (グループを削除) ・書式 groupdel グループ名passwd (ユーザのパスワードを作成・修正) ・書式 passwd [オプション] ユーザ名・オプション -l ユーザアカウントをロック -u ユーザアカウントをアンロック -d ユーザアカウントのパスワードを削除 |
All Rights Reserved. Copyright (C) ITCL |